Pingyao Ancient City, a UNESCO World Heritage Site located in Shanxi Province, China, is renowned for its well-preserved historical architecture and vibrant culture. Among its many attractions, the sacred temples and religious sites stand out, offering visitors a glimpse into the spiritual heritage of this ancient city. Each temple serves not only as a place of worship but also as a testament to Pingyao's rich history.
One of the most significant religious sites in Pingyao is the Qingxu Temple, originally built during the Tang Dynasty. This Taoist temple complex features beautifully crafted pavilions and majestic halls dedicated to various deities of Taoism. Visitors can wander through the tranquil grounds, where they will find intricately carved statues and serene gardens that promote a sense of peace and reflection. The temple also hosts numerous festivals and ceremonies, attracting both locals and tourists alike.
Another notable site is the Confucius Temple, a vital center for Confucian thought and education. Established in the Song Dynasty, this temple honors Confucius, the founder of Confucianism. The architecture mirrors traditional Chinese styles, adorned with colorful roof tiles and stone carvings. Visitors can observe ancient calligraphy and inscriptions that pay homage to Confucian ideals, making the temple a vital link to China’s philosophical heritage.
The Northern Temple is another essential site, known for its stunning architectural design and rich cultural significance. This Buddhist temple complex provides insight into the development of Buddhism in the region. With its serene atmosphere, colorful murals depicting Buddhist teachings, and intricate sculptures, the Northern Temple serves not only as a place for meditation and prayer but also as an educational hub for those interested in Buddhist practices.
The Ancient City Wall of Pingyao also holds spiritual significance. As one of the best-preserved city walls in China, this formidable structure encompasses numerous temples and shrines. Visitors can take a walk along the wall and discover small altars and offerings placed by worshippers who seek blessings for protection and prosperity.
